Abstract

The present subject matter is directed to a method for treating a conscious. The method includes selecting a conscious patient having impaired cognitive function and applying electrical stimulation to at least a portion of the patient's intralaminar nuclei under conditions effective to relieve the patient's impaired cognitive function. A method for improving coordination of function across a patient's cortical regions is also described. The method includes applying electrical stimulation to two or more subdivisions of the patient's intralaminar nuclei. The two or more subdivisions of the patient's intralaminar nuclei modulate separate cortical regions. Using the methods of the present invention, patients suffering from impaired cognitive function can have at least a portion of the function restored, thus improving their quality of life and reducing societal costs.
